Peter Dutton has promised business leaders cheaper energy prices and less government interference under the Coalition.

will promise business leaders cheaper energy prices and less government interference under the Coalition, pledging to stay out of the way of employment and profit growth through a simplified industrial relations system.

“The Coalition understands the critical role that small businesses will play in helping to lift productivity and living standards in the decades ahead,” he will tell COSBOA’s annual summit in Sydney.“The government’s ignorance of, and ideological opposition towards, small business is exposed in its industrial relations agenda. The new laws make an IR system steeped in bureaucratic complexity even more bureaucratically complex.

A year out from the next election, Mr Dutton will use the speech to call for sustainable wage growth delivered through productivity enhancements, saying Labor only seeks wage increases knowing someone else must foot the bill. “With nuclear, we can maximise the highest yield of energy per square metre and minimise our environmental footprint,” he will say.

Mr Dutton says it is bizarre that Australia is the only top 20 economy globally without domestic nuclear power in place or plans for its development.He will call on business leaders to speak up in their own interest, and not fear public criticism or social media insults, adding: “I meet with CEOs and chairs in private who vigorously express their frustration about the government’s damaging policies.
